From 68bb3c43c720afe7f88bc839fffc45a9b4ecd883 Mon Sep 17 00:00:00 2001 From: Paul Makles Date: Sun, 27 Oct 2024 21:47:02 +0000 Subject: [PATCH] fix: strip new lines from private key --- generate_config.sh |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/generate_config.sh b/generate_config.sh index ff53702..4fe406c 100755 --- a/generate_config.sh +++ b/generate_config.sh @@ -15,8 +15,9 @@ echo "january = \"https://$1/january\"" >> Revolt.toml echo "" >> Revolt.toml echo "[api.vapid]" >> Revolt.toml openssl ecparam -name prime256v1 -genkey -noout -out vapid_private.pem -echo "private_key = \"$(base64 vapid_private.pem)\"" >> Revolt.toml +echo "private_key = \"$(base64 vapid_private.pem | tr -d '\n')\"" >> Revolt.toml echo "public_key = \"$(openssl ec -in vapid_private.pem -outform DER|tail -c 65|base64|tr '/+' '_-'|tr -d '\n')\"" >> Revolt.toml +rm vapid_private.pem # encryption key for files echo "" >> Revolt.toml